Making Conscious Choices: From Floorboards to Framework


When it comes to picking materials, the series of eco-conscious options has actually never been more plentiful. Reclaimed timber, for instance, uses a warm, rustic appeal while giving new life to previously utilized products. Bamboo is one more preferred choice for floor covering-- fast-growing and highly sustainable, it brings a modern look with a considerably reduced ecological cost. For insulation, all-natural alternatives like sheep's wool or cellulose supply excellent thermal security without harmful chemicals. Even paints and adhesives now can be found in low-VOC or zero-VOC formulations, decreasing poisonous exhausts inside the home.

Bringing the Outdoors In with Sustainable Decking Options


Outdoor spaces are just as essential when thinking about an eco-friendly strategy. Decks, patio areas, and yards all supply opportunities to combine convenience with preservation. Typical outdoor decking products, such as without treatment timber, may come with high maintenance demands and much shorter life-spans. Luckily, there are much better options today. Composite outdoor decking, made from a mix of recycled wood and plastics, has gained appeal for its long-lasting sturdiness and minimized environmental influence. It resembles the look of wood without the demand for extreme sealants or constant repair services.

Small Changes, Big Results: Everyday Sustainability in your home


Even if you're not handling a major improvement, tiny updates can still make a large distinction. Switching out old light bulbs for LEDs, setting up a wise water heater, or replacing single-pane windows with insulated ones can considerably decrease a home's energy usage. Lasting living doesn't have to be overwhelming-- it's often the buildup of thoughtful selections that causes enduring change.


And it's not just about the first installment. Maintenance plays a major duty in prolonging the life of your home and the materials you've picked. Sealing cracks, checking water use, and keeping HVAC systems tidy are ongoing behaviors that protect efficiency and shield your investment.
